Spas Delev is a 36-year-old football player who plays as a striker for PFC Lokomotiv Sofia 1929, born on 22. September 1989. Follow Spas Delev on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.
In the 2025/2026 First Professional League season, Spas Delev has recorded 8 goals, 11 assists, 3.003 minutes, 2 yellow cards.
Spas Delev scores highly on Goals, Assists, and Minutes compared to strikers in the First Professional League.

Spas Delev's career has also included time at Ludogorets Razgrad II, Ludogorets Razgrad, Arda Kardzhali, Pogoń Szczecin, Beroe, Lokomotiv Plovdiv, Las Palmas, CSKA Sofia, Mersin İdman Yurdu Spor Kulübü, and Pirin Blagoevgrad.
On the international stage, Spas Delev has represented Bulgaria and Bulgaria U21.

Throughout their career, Spas Delev has won 6 titles: Cup (2010/2011) and Super Cup (2011/2012) with CSKA Sofia and Cup (2022/2023), Super Cup (2022/2023), and First League (2022/2023, 2021/2022) with Ludogorets Razgrad.
